BRS leader K.T. Rama Rao has demanded the resignation of the Union Education Minister over the NEET paper leak. He criticized the central government's handling of student protests and accused the state government of political diversion.

The Bharat Rashtra Samithi (BRS) demanded that the Prime Minister make Union Education Minister Dharmendra Pradhan resign, withdraw all the cases foisted by the police against the youth and students protesting in New Delhi and tender an unconditional apology on the excesses committed against the protesters seeking action in the NEET question paper leakage issue.
